Program Notes

The Overture is an introduction of a longer work, The Song of Songs, an Oratorio.


"Song of Songs is a particular book in the holy Scriptures, for it is not a book of history, law, prophecy, or gospel. It is a poem of the history of love in an excellent marrriage. It is a romance of the highest standard. The entire Bible is a romance, a love story, of God 'falling in love' with man". Quote from Life study of Song of Songs by Witness Lee; Life study one.


The mood changes throughout the overture, according to feeling expressed in the story. It contains some of the major musical themes of the oratorio.
